Sun Protection and Its Role

Importance of sunscreen for oily skin. Recommended sunscreen types and application tips.

Wearing sunscreen is key for oily skin. It protects from harmful sun rays and prevents breakouts. Look for sunscreens that say “oil-free” or “non-comedogenic.” These won’t clog your pores. Apply it every morning, even on cloudy days!

  • Use products with SPF 30 or higher.
  • Check for ingredients like zinc oxide or titanium dioxide.
  • Reapply every two hours, especially if you’re sweating.

FAQs

What Are The Best Cleanser Options For Oily Skin In A Daily Skincare Routine?

For oily skin, you should choose a gentle foaming cleanser. Look for ingredients like salicylic acid or tea tree oil. These help keep your skin clear and fresh. Use the cleanser twice a day—once in the morning and once at night. Always rinse well with cool water to remove any leftover soap.

How Often Should I Exfoliate If I Have Oily Skin?

If you have oily skin, you should exfoliate about 1 to 2 times a week. This helps remove extra oil and dead skin. Use a gentle scrub or exfoliating wash. Always be careful not to scrub too hard. After exfoliating, remember to moisturize your skin!

What Type Of Moisturizer Is Suitable For Oily Skin Without Causing Breakouts?

If you have oily skin, you should look for a lightweight moisturizer. Gel or water-based ones work best. They hydrate your skin without feeling heavy. Make sure it says “non-comedogenic” on the label. This means it won’t clog your pores and cause breakouts.

Should I Use Toner In My Daily Routine, And If So, What Ingredients Should I Look For?

Yes, you can use toner in your daily routine! It helps clean your skin and makes it feel fresh. Look for ingredients like witch hazel, which helps with oily skin, or aloe vera, which is soothing. Rose water is nice too because it smells good and hydrates your skin. Just make sure your toner is alcohol-free, so it doesn’t dry you out!

How Can I Incorporate Sunscreen Into My Daily Skin Routine Without Making My Skin Feel Greasy?

To avoid greasy skin, choose a lightweight sunscreen. Look for one that says “matte” or “oil-free.” You can use a gel sunscreen or a spray. Apply it after your moisturizer, but before makeup. Remember to reapply it every two hours when you are outside!
